Not all of us are blessed with desirable teeth structure since birth or due to some circumstances which impacted our pearly whites negatively. With that a dental makeover may be needed to bring that beautiful smile or confidence level up. This is made possible by certain procedures with indispensable restorative effect. They improve the appearance of the gums and teeth and change the lives of concerned patients as well.

To keep teeth complete, there are different procedures which the dentists perform for the patients' sake. Dental fillings are often installed to fill in the empty spaces in the gums caused by cavities. The good thing about having them installed nowadays is that currents look like the natural pearly whites in every way.

In the case of chipped and cracked teeth, there are two procedures which can provide that perfect dental makeover. These are composite bonding and use of veneers. Chips may seem like a small problem and so patients do not pay much attention on them. But the truth is they can cause mouth injuries if left unattended. In composite bonding the teeth are first cleaned and shaped to its natural form with the use of resins. Veneers, on the other hand, are thin porcelain pieces which are placed on the surface of the chipped teeth. They are shaped and colored according to the natural color of your teeth just like what happens in composite bonding. Veneers are also advantageous in a way that they keep the teeth from falling out.

Installation of dentures also characterizes cosmetic dentistry - the branch of dentistry that includes the procedures mentioned above. These are artificial teeth which rest on the gums and are purposely made to act like real teeth. Misaligned and overlapping teeth are some problems that are common among adults and kids. These are corrected with the use of braces which also correct a bad bite. While straightening out the teeth, braces provide patients the opportunity to brush and floss with ease. Patients who cannot stand wearing braces turn to contouring or reshaping instead. This is painless and gives quick results but could be costly than braces.

Have you ever heard of abrasion treatment? This is perfect for the curing of small cavities afflicting the back teeth. In replacement to anesthesia and drilling tools, high-powered stream of air is utilized to attach a powdery substance on the concerned teeth. This powdery substance takes the decay off the surface of the teeth and bonds the teeth afterwards. Finally, there is also treatment which addresses discoloration or stains on the teeth. Teeth whitening procedures can remove the stains which regular brushing or flossing cannot undo.

With the advancements in technology, achieving dental makeover in a painless and quick way is no longer impossible. Many dental clinics offer them as part of their services at different prices. To ensure the safety of your gums and teeth and secure your money's worth, keep in touch only with a reliable dentist who is experienced in carrying out these procedures.
